Yes, it is possible to obtain a master's degree in education without any prior teaching experience. Many graduate programs in education accept students from diverse backgrounds, including those without prior teaching experience. However, some programs may require relevant work or volunteer experience in the field of education.

A resume for a lab assistant position should include relevant education, laboratory skills, experience, certifications, and any relevant coursework or projects. It should also highlight any specific technical skills, such as knowledge of lab equipment or software, and any relevant research experience. Additionally, including any relevant volunteer work or extracurricular activities can help demonstrate your interest and experience in the field.
